Step 2: Choose Your Tempo and Genre
Tempo decides how fast or slow your beat moves. For example:
- Hip-hop beats are usually 80–100 BPM.
- Trap beats are around 140 BPM.
- House or EDM beats are 120–130 BPM.

Step 3: Build the Drum Pattern
Your drum pattern is the backbone of the beat. Start with a kick (the heavy thump), then add a snare (the clap), and finally some hi-hats to give rhythm and flow.
Logic Pro’s Step Sequencer is a beginner-friendly tool for this. It lets you visually arrange drum hits in a grid pattern. You can also experiment with swing, velocity, and timing.

Step 5: Add a Bassline
The bassline gives your beat depth and power. In Logic Pro, you can use the ES2 Synth or Alchemy Bass Presets to create fat, rich bass tones.

Step 8: Export and Share Your Beat
After mixing and mastering, you’re ready to export your beat. Go to File → Bounce → Project or Section, and select the format you want — usually MP3 or WAV.
